The story follows based on the beloved novella by Denis Johnson, Train Dreams is the moving portrait of Robert Grainier (Golden Globe-nominee Joel Edgerton), whose life unfolds during an era of unprecedented change in early 20th century America. Orphaned at a young age, Robert grows into adulthood among the towering forests of the Pacific Northwest, where he helps expand the nation's railroad empire alongside men as unforgettable as the landscapes they inhabit. After a tender courtship, he marries Gladys (Academy Award-nominee Felicity Jones) and they build a home together, though his work often takes him far from her and their young daughter. When his life takes an unexpected turn, Robert finds beauty, brutality and newfound meaning for the forests and trees he has felled. "Bentley renders Idaho and this way of life around the turn of the 20th century in such a mystical and mysterious way, it almost seems like science fiction."
"Beautiful, moving, and thoughtful."
"Joel Edgerton brings a quiet soulfulness to "Train Dreams" that perfectly complements director Clint Bentley's meditative portrait of an unassuming logger making his way through early 20th century America, and beyond."
"Train Dreams washes over you, the way a slow-paced life can do, if you can let it. If not, well, you can still enjoy the pretty trees for a bit."
"The movie’s lyrical direction and writing, its screenplay’s epic scope... and its soulful performances all combine to create this highly emotional meditation on the relationship between work and family, humans and the land, and humans and time."
"There's no grand action to hook viewers, no predictable formula to follow. Instead, the film feels very much a literary adaptation, especially with its somewhat superfluous voiceover filling in narrative gaps."
